Sodium-ion Scale-up Drives Demand for Battery-Grade Aluminum Foil, Industry Enters New Phase of Structural Optimization

As sodium-ion batteries enter the phase of large-scale commercialization, battery-grade aluminum foil—a critical material shared by both lithium-ion and sodium-ion batteries—has seen significantly rising demand. Data shows that the price of 12μm double-bright aluminum foil increased from RMB 36,800 per ton in early January 2026 to RMB 38,600 per ton by July 10, representing a cumulative rise of RMB 1,800 per ton, or nearly 5%. Since the beginning of this year, aluminum foil manufacturers have widely implemented price increases for customers, with processing fees cumulatively raised by RMB 1,000–1,500 per ton. The industry is highly concentrated, with the market share of leading players reaching approximately 38%. Both the anode and cathode of sodium-ion batteries use aluminum foil, and the aluminum foil consumption per GWh is double that of lithium-ion batteries. Moreover, specialized carbon-coated aluminum foil for sodium-ion batteries commands a notable premium in processing fees, further expanding profit margins. On the supply side, the long lead time for high-end aluminum foil production equipment has resulted in slow capacity expansion. On the demand side, major battery makers are scheduled to commission large-scale sodium-ion battery plants in the third and fourth quarters of 2026, driving sustained procurement demand for aluminum foil and potentially tightening the spot supply of high-end, sodium-ion-specific aluminum foil. Additionally, composite aluminum foil—emerging as a next-generation, high-safety current collector material—has already been adapted for sodium-ion battery systems and is poised to capture incremental markets in both energy storage and power applications for sodium-ion batteries, serving as a strong complement to the high-end aluminum foil segment. With traditional aluminum foil supply and demand remaining in a tight balance, coupled with long-term demand growth driven by sodium-ion battery expansion and the premium development trajectory of composite aluminum foil, the battery-grade aluminum foil industry is entering a new phase of structural optimization.
